The longest crystal ever recorded is a selenite crystal found in the Cave of the Crystals in Chihuahua, Mexico. This crystal measures about 12 meters (39 feet) in length and is estimated to be around 500,000 years old. These massive selenite crystals were formed in a unique geological environment, resulting in their extraordinary size.

Crystal caves are typically formed through a combination of geological processes such as the seepage of mineral-rich groundwater, temperature changes, and pressure variations. Over time, minerals like gypsum, calcite, or quartz are deposited on cave surfaces, forming dazzling crystal formations. The specific formation process can vary depending on the type of minerals present and the environmental conditions of the cave.

Crystal Lake Cave was formed approximately 200 million years ago when limestone bedrock was dissolved by acidic groundwater, creating underground passages and chambers. Over time, the cave continued to grow and develop through the process of precipitation, where mineral deposits built up to form the beautiful formations seen today.
